    LAST STOP COCHIN(ERNAKULAM)!!
    Well this being our last place to be visited in our trip....welcome to the city of Harbors...
    the city contains of two more islands one is Wellington and the other is Vypeen island..all the three that is Ernakulam ,Vypeen and the Wellington have the main transport between them as ferries....getting from one island to another..in ferriy is altogether a new experience....u somehow get lost in the no. of people of diff custom and work getting into the ferry getting off it..and then running to diff directions..as if suddenly there be flood in an ant hill....so the ants running everywhere without knowing where they are heading......
    Now we reached cochin in night so we again took a three-bed room ..now we all are used to sleeping together ..hehe..when we get up in the morning no one was at the place where he slept in the night...it was as if each one of us had swapped our places in the night but nobody knows when that thing happened......we all set for the FortCochi..the place where..there was an old church made by the dutch people....then we saw the shore......and then we set for a ferry ride to the Vypeen island..it was so much fun..to get into the sea-side village life...the island was so quite and serene.....travelling to such places give u time to think something other than this worldly thing something which doesn't belong tro this world......something which is in everyone...now im again drifting to this unknown world..get back,,..so we went for the Cheriyar beach on the islands southern most point....we were surprised to see the same foreigners on this island those whom we met during our cruise from Kullam to Allepey...we just shared a smile and went our ways..hehe...it was all so coincidental....now went to Wellington island again via a ferry..i kindda satretd to like these ferry rides...there was this large dockyard..that we went to see...for our surprise..there were two ships being docked..one was full with import cargo from (singapore)and the other full of export cargo (kenya)..now that was when i really saw what export and import is all about.....the ship was so huge..my God i measured it to be about 240 walking steps..this was huge.....so we had our brunch and then were back to visit the main Ernakulam by evening....the city is quite a developing one with neon-lights market..big showrooms..and quite a few funky eating -joints....but then everything went slow by about 9 o'clock in night..now what the hell this city had no night life....so we went for the multiplex..to watch a hindi movies called Tujhe Meri Kasam(actually we wanted just pass our tiome coz our train back to Calicut was at 1:30 a.m. ..the movie was really turned to be a time pass for it has no story and a very bad acting by the new actor...the actress looked cool and the character she played quite suited her....personality....so we were out from the cinema hall by 12 and into the train by 1:30 a.m. and into our berths sleeping like logs by 1:31 a.m. ..he he..we didn't even see where we were sleeping..just saw the berth no.threw our bags on the berth and slept......it was only in the morning...that somebody woke me up..and told me that the next station was Calicut...so my journey ended rather peacefully without any sufferings......actually it is said that when u go for a SAFAR u have to "SUFFER"..but it was not true in my case ..coz i enjoyed everybit of my SAFAR......So thats it guys hope u liked the whole tour..and will surely visit the GOD's OWN COUNTRY (Kerala) someday.....till next C U.
